Subject: [release] TaxTally rate-lookup cache rollout, wave 2

Hi all — welcome to the new folks on the Fernley team. Tonight we're rolling the warmed tax-rate lookup cache to the remaining regions. For context: the cache holds jurisdiction rate tables for 24 hours and falls back to the live rate service on miss, so a cold start is slow but never wrong. Please watch the miss-rate dashboard for the first hour after cutover. The deployment artifact carries the token below.

build token for bahif-kawig: htk21_9cc972c67d58f746a5122

# Client setup for Inkpress, our internal PDF invoice renderer.
# We batch invoices nightly from the Ledgerly queue; retries are
# handled upstream, so keep timeouts short here (5s max).
# Reviewer note: the render endpoint rejects unauthenticated calls
# since the Quillhaven migration. The service key it expects is below.

gateway credential: kto23_LX9A4ys6i4nzHtpOLNLodKK

## Onboarding — Markdown Pipeline (Inkmere)

Inkmere docs render through a three-stage pipeline: parse, sanitize, emit. Releases rebuild all templates; never hot-patch emitted HTML. Broken renders usually mean a sanitizer rule change — check the rules diff first. The render cluster only accepts builds from the release channel, and every build artifact must be signed before upload. Sign artifacts with the deploy key below.

release key, hafop-tajef: bky13_s2vaFVNJTHfBL

// REPLICA_LAG_ALARM_SECONDS — threshold at which Quillbase raises the
// read-replica lag alarm that your plugin may receive via the health hook.
// Plugin authors: treat values above this as stale-read territory and
// degrade gracefully rather than retrying aggressively. Changing this
// requires coordination with the storage team. Reference build token below.

trace token, kahog-tajeg: htk6_97d963

☐ Sweeper key rotation. Before cutting the Holloway release, rotate the signing key for SweepRite, the data-retention sweeper. Confirm last sweep completed, pause the schedule, generate the new key in the Dunmore enclave, and have both custodians attest. Do not resume sweeps until the release manager countersigns. Then seal the envelope containing the recovery passphrase written below.

unlock words, fafop-hawep: briwyn-oliix-sorox